**Crafting Childhood into Cashflow: Turning Childhood Interests into Skills, Creativity and Income in 2026**

What if the things a child naturally loves doing today could become the skills they build their future around tomorrow?

In a rapidly changing world, childhood is no longer only about preparing for traditional careers. The digital economy is creating new possibilities for young people to turn curiosity, creativity, hobbies and practical skills into meaningful opportunities. **Crafting Childhood into Cashflow** explores how parents, educators and young learners can recognise these opportunities and thoughtfully transform childhood interests into valuable skills, projects and potential income streams.

From drawing and storytelling to photography, gaming, coding, crafting, content creation and digital design, children are growing up surrounded by tools that previous generations could hardly imagine. Artificial intelligence, online learning platforms, digital marketplaces and creator economies are changing how skills can be developed and monetised. But turning an interest into income should never mean rushing children into the world of work. The real objective is to develop confidence, creativity, problem-solving ability, financial awareness and entrepreneurial thinking while keeping childhood healthy, balanced and enjoyable.

This book presents a practical framework for understanding that journey.

You will discover how to: - Identify a child's genuine interests, strengths and natural talents

- Convert hobbies into useful, future-ready skills

- Introduce entrepreneurship without taking away the joy of childhood

- Use AI and digital tools responsibly as learning assistants

- Develop creative projects that can become portfolios or small ventures

- Understand the basics of personal finance, saving, pricing and budgeting

- Explore age-appropriate digital opportunities in the creator economy

- Help children learn communication, marketing and problem-solving

- Build a simple pathway from **Interest → Skill → Project → Value → Opportunity**

- Encourage experimentation while treating mistakes as part of learning

- Create healthy boundaries around screen time, online safety and digital exposure

- Prepare young people for a world where adaptability may matter as much as qualifications

**Crafting Childhood into Cashflow** is not a promise of overnight wealth, nor is it a guide to making children chase money. Instead, it offers a different perspective: **money can become the outcome of creating something useful, solving a problem, developing a skill or serving a genuine need.**

The book also examines the changing landscape of 2026, where AI-assisted creativity, digital products, online education, freelancing, content creation and global marketplaces are opening doors that did not exist for previous generations. At the same time, it highlights an important principle: technology should amplify human creativity, not replace curiosity, judgement, effort and originality.

For parents, the book provides ideas for nurturing entrepreneurial thinking at home. For teachers and mentors, it offers a framework for connecting learning with real-world value. For young readers, it presents the possibility that their interests are not merely hobbies - they may be the starting points for discovering skills, solving problems and creating something of their own.
